Billie Dean Letts (née Gipson; May 30, 1938 – August 2, 2014) was an American novelist and educator. She was a professor at Southeastern Oklahoma State University.

Family

She was married to professor-turned-actor Dennis Letts until his death in 2008. The couple had three children: Dana, Tracy Letts, a playwright, and Shawn (a jazz musician/composer).

Personal life

Letts was born as Billie Dean Gipson in Tulsa, Oklahoma, the daughter of Virginia M. (Barnes), a secretary, and William C. Gipson. She married Dennis Letts, a professor and actor, in 1958. Dennis Letts served as his wife's editor for her own novels. He died of lung cancer in Tulsa on February 22, 2008, aged 73.

Death

Billie Letts died in a Tulsa hospital from pneumonia on August 2, 2014, aged 76. She had recently been diagnosed with acute myeloid leukemia.

Novels

  • Where the Heart Is (1995)
  • The Honk and Holler Opening Soon (1998)
  • Shoot the Moon (2004)
  • Made in the U.S.A. (2008)
